**Chelsea’s Pursuit of Samu Omorodion**
Chelsea’s quest for a new striker has led them to identify Samu Omorodion as their primary target. The young Atletico Madrid forward has caught the eye of Stamford Bridge bosses after an impressive loan spell at Alaves, where he netted eight goals last season. Despite Chelsea’s initial bid of €40m being rejected, they remain keen on securing his services.
**Atletico Madrid’s Stance on Omorodion**
Atletico Madrid, however, have set a high asking price for Omorodion, with reports indicating that they will only consider a deal if his €80m release clause is met. The player himself seems uncertain about leaving the Spanish capital for the Premier League, with interest also coming from Serie A clubs Roma and Napoli. With four years left on his contract, Atleti hold a strong position in negotiations.
**Omorodion’s Attributes and Potential Impact**
Standing at an imposing 6 ft 4 in, Omorodion possesses a blend of physicality, aerial ability, speed, and agility that make him a formidable presence up front. His tenacious work ethic and pressing style could align well with Chelsea’s tactical approach under Enzo Maresca. Diego Simeone, Atletico Madrid’s manager, has expressed admiration for the young striker’s qualities, hinting at a bright future for him at the club.
